PLACEBO-CONTROLLED SAFETY STUDY OF RITLECITINIB (PF-06651600) IN ADULTS WITH ALOPECIA AREATA

A PHASE 2a, RANDOMIZED, DOUBLE-BLIND, PLACEBO-CONTROLLED STUDY INVESTIGATING THE SAFETY OF RITLECITINIB (PF-06651600) IN ADULT PARTICIPANTS WITH ALOPECIA AREATA

Brief summary

This is a global Phase 2a randomized, double-blind, placebo-controlled study to evaluate the safety and tolerability of ritlecitinib in adults aged 18 to ≤50 years of age with ≥25% scalp hair loss due to Alopecia Areata (AA).

Inclusion criteria

* Diagnosis of alopecia areata, including alopecia totalis and alopecia universalis. * At least 25% hair loss due to alopecia areata * Must have normal hearing and normal brainstem auditory evoked potentials (BAEPs) * Must have a normal neurological exam; can have a stable unilateral median neuropathy or ulnar neuropathy * Signed informed consent * Stable regimen for other medications before and during the study

Exclusion criteria

* Other significant medical conditions * Occupational or recreational noise exposure * History of peripheral neuropathy or first degree relative with a hereditary peripheral neuropathy * HbA1c \> or = 7.5% at Screening * Recurrent or disseminated Herpes Zoster * Active or chronic infection; or infection requiring hospitalization or IV antimicrobials within 6 months * Active or latent (insufficiently treated) Hepatitis * Active or latent (insufficiently treated) TB * Concomitant medications associated with peripheral neurologic or hearing loss * Protocol specific laboratory abnormalities

MeasureTime frameDescription
Change From Baseline in I-V Interwave Latency on Brainstem Auditory Evoked Potentials (BAEP) at a Stimulus Intensity of 80 Decibels (dB) From the Right Side at Month 9Baseline, Month 9 (Baseline was defined as the last non-missing measurement obtained before the first dose in the placebo-controlled phase)BAEP interwave I-V latency (in milliseconds) was the primary endpoint for this study. High-intensity stimulation (80dB) was used. Participants had BAEP evaluations performed at the same evaluation center, by the same audiology professional using the same equipment, during the study. Audiology and BAEP evaluations were done on the same day, with audiology assessment first. If they could not be done on the same day, assessments had to be within 7 days of each other. A central reader was used for BAEP to confirm that locally read BAEP waves were labelled appropriately and at their peak so that latency were accurate. Central reading also ensured consistency in BAEP interpretation.

Change From Baseline in Percentage of Intraepidermal Nerve Fiber (IENF) With Axonal Swelling in Skin Punch Biopsies at Month 9Baseline, Month 9 (Month 6 for the 2 participants who entered the Active Therapy Extension Phase at Month 6). Baseline was defined as the last non-missing measurement obtained before the first dose in the placebo-controlled phase.The endpoint axonal dystrophy referred to the percentage of IENF with axonal swellings. Axonal swellings were evaluated in peripheral skin punch biopsies from the distal part of lower extremities. Axonal swellings were counted by axon. Any IENF with single or multiple swellings was counted as a single event, ie, a single axon with axonal swellings. For each participant, data were reported as the percentage of IENF with any number of swellings. IENF was assessed at Day 1 and Month 9. Participants who had entered the Active Therapy Extension Phase at Month 6 had a skin punch biopsy taken at Month 6 for IENF assessments instead of at Month 9. The skin biopsy was collected before the start of Active Therapy Extension Phase.

Change From Baseline in Intraepidermal Nerve Fiber Density (IENFD) in Skin Punch Biopsies at Month 9Baseline, Month 9 (Month 6 for the 2 participants who entered the Active Therapy Extension Phase at Month 6). Baseline was defined as the last non-missing measurement obtained before the first dose in the placebo-controlled phase.IENFD was evaluated in peripheral skin punch biopsies from the distal part of lower extremities. IENFD was measured by counting the number of fibers and fiber branches that independently crossed the dermal-epidermal barrier (basement membrane). Secondary branching was excluded from quantification and fragments were not counted. The length of the histology section was measured (mm) and the linear epidermal nerve fiber density was reported as number of intraepidermal nerve fibers/mm.

Change From Baseline in Overall Severity of Alopecia Tool (SALT) Scores up to Month 9Baseline, Months 3, 6 and 9 (Baseline was defined as the last non-missing measurement obtained before the first dose in the placebo-controlled phase)SALT is a quantitative assessment of AA severity based on scalp terminal hair loss. The overall SALT score included hair loss regardless of etiology (ie, scalp hair loss due to both non-AA and AA) and was collected at study visits. The Overall SALT Score ranged from 0 to 100%, with higher scores representing greater amount of hair loss.

A total of 131 participants were screened for this study; 71 participants were enrolled and randomized to double-blind treatment and treated. All enrolled participants received tablets until Month 24 and then all but 2 switched to capsules at the start of Extension Phase.

Participants by arm

ArmCount
Ritlecitinib 200/50/50 mg QD
In the 9-Month Placebo-Controlled Phase, each participant received ritlecitinib 200 mg QD (50 mg/tablet ×4) during the initial 4-week period, and received 1 tablet of ritlecitinib 50 mg QD during the remainder of this treatment phase. In the 15-Month Active Therapy Extension Phase, each participant received 1 tablet of ritlecitinib 50 mg QD and 3 tablets of placebo QD during the initial 4-week period, and then received 1 tablet of ritlecitinib 50 mg QD during the remainder of this phase.
36
Placebo -> Ritlecitinib 200/50 mg QD
In the 9-month Placebo-Controlled Phase, each participant received a total of 4 tablets of Placebo QD during the initial 4-week period, and received 1 tablet of Placebo QD during the remainder of this treatment phase. In the 15-month Active Therapy Extension Phase, each participant received Ritlecitinib 200 mg QD (50 mg/tablet ×4) during the initial 4-week period, and then received 1 tablet of Ritlecitinib 50 mg QD during the remainder of this treatment phase.
